A global infrastructure consulting firm is seeking a Senior Lighting Designer to deliver significant projects across the UK and internationally. The candidate will manage engineering tasks, provide technical expertise across multi-disciplinary projects, and create innovative lighting designs.
Ideal applicants will have:
- a relevant technical qualification,
- proven design experience,
- proficiency in industry-standard software.
The role offers a flexible hybrid working model, providing a suit for both personal and professional development.
